WWE Monday Night RAW superstar Roman Reigns, who was pulled over the weekend from the WWE: Tables, Ladders & Chairs pay-per-view due to illness, is expected to return shortly before the WWE Survivor Series pay-per-view on November 19th, according to a report from Pro Wrestling Sheet.

As mentioned several times over the weekend, Reigns, Bray Wyatt, Bo Dallas and ring announcer JoJo Offerman were all pulled from the pay-per-view due to the illness.

The report notes that while that is the current time frame for Reigns’ return, it is always possible, that for storyline purposes, that he will be kept of WWE television until after the WWE Survivor Series pay-per-view.
